4 Servings, about 3 tablespoons each, plus 4 servings for another meal or snack.Preparation Time: 10 Minutes Canned chickpeas, drained 1 15-1/2 ounce can Vegetable oil 2 tablespoons Lemon juice 1 tablespoon Onion, chopped 2 tablespoons Salt 1/2 teaspoon 1. Mash chickpeas in a small bowl until they are smooth. 2. Add oil and lemon juice; stir to combine. 3. Add chopped onions and salt. 4. Serve on bread or crackers. Note: Garbanzo bean is another name for chickpea. PER SERVING: Calories 90 Total fat 4 grams Saturated fat Trace Cholesterol 0 Sodium 148 milligrams United States Department of AgricultureCenter for Nutrition Policy and Promotion
